Risk Assessment Workshop (RAW)
RAW is a software support tool designed to assist you with the assessment of risk in a Risk Management Process within a region, organisation or department. See Risk Assessment for more details.
It was primarily designed for use by Local Councils but can adapted to other organisations.
RAW works in the following Risk Management phases:
- Identify hazards and threats - RAW assists in the identification of Hazards and Threats by providing you with an efficient tool to store and work with threats. It helps you to provide consistency across a region, organisation or department.
- Analyse risks - RAW supports qualitative risk assessments and provides the ability to record, sort and filter data by all its characteristics.
- Evaluate Risks - RAW's Risk Register allows you to collect treatments against the risks and analyse the effect of implementing the treatments. It can formally demonstrate successful risk management.
Key features and benefits
- Formal Risk Assessment - formally demonstrate successful risk management.
- Can create multiple Regions - each Region is defined as one or more communities. You can one or more Regions defined.
- Risks recorded at the Community level - risks are specific to each community in the region.
- Controls can be recorded against each risk - controls along with responsible party can be record for each risk.
- Risk Reports - various reports available. For example, list top 10 risks without controls.
